In the construction of reinforced concrete buildings, the joining of rebars is essential, and its significanceincreases as the structures being built become more complex. Several methods of rebar joining exist. Recently, a one-touch type rebar coupler, a type of mechanical joint, has been widely used owing to itsvarious advantages. The housing of the one-touch type rebar coupler primarily employs SCM440. To meet theperformance requirements of mechanical joining, an appropriate heat treatment is necessary. In this study,tensile tests were conducted on SCM440 specimens before and after heat treatment to understand themechanical properties of the materials used in rebar couplers. The heat treatment was applied to enhance thestrength and toughness of SCM440 via quenching and tempering (QT). The analysis of the tensile test resultsconfirmed a significant improvement in the mechanical properties of SCM440.
